2

我有一个有向图,将重叠边集中到一个边上。下面给出了一个示例 .dot 文件:

strict digraph Test {
concentrate=true
A -> B;
A -> B;
A -> B;
}

我想将重叠边缘的数量显示为边缘标签。这听起来很微不足道,但我无法弄清楚如何做到这一点。这可能吗?如果可能的话,我该怎么做?

谢谢你。

4

1 回答 1

2

唯一的方法是自己对 .gv 文件进行一些后处理,然后再将其提供给 dot。您必须修改输出以明确包含所需的文本,例如:

strict digraph Test
{
    concentrate=true
    A -> B [label="3 connections between A and B"];
}
于 2014-08-11T00:10:05.027 回答